神农架常绿落叶阔叶混交林和亚高山针叶林植物群落特征数据集

摘要: 植物物种组成和群落特征是森林生态系统结构、功能和动态的基础,决定了森林生态系统的生产力、碳固存和生物多样性保育等生态系统服务功能,是中国生态系统研究网络(CERN)和国家生态系统观测研究网络(CNERN)陆地生态系统生物要素长期观测的重要指标。常绿落叶阔叶混交林是中国北亚热带的地带性植被类型,是对环境变化响应敏感的植被类型之一。亚高山针叶林是神农架山地垂直带谱上部典型的植被类型,保存有华中地区仅存的大面积的天然原始林,是秦巴山地重要的生态屏障。中国科学院神农架生物多样性定位研究站暨湖北神农架森林生态系统国家野外科学观测研究站于2001年和2008年分别建立了100 m×100 m的亚高山针叶林长期样地和常绿落叶阔叶混交林长期样地。2010年按照CERN和CNERN监测规范开展了植物群落清查。在100个10 m × 10 m次级样方开展乔木层调查,在13个10 m × 10 m次级样方开展灌木层和草本层调查。乔木层的调查对象为全部所有胸径≥1 cm 的木本植物个体,调查指标包括植物物种名、胸径、高度等;灌木层的监测对象为胸径<1 cm的木本植物,调查指标包括物种名、多度、平均基径、平均高度、盖度等;草本层的监测对象为草本植物,调查指标包括物种名、多度、平均高度、盖度等。通过统计整理形成了本数据集的6个数据表:(1)乔木层物种名、多度、平均胸径、平均高度、盖度、生活型,(2)乔木次级样方的优势种、物种数、密度、优势种平均高度和郁闭度,(3)灌木层物种名、多度、平均基径、平均高度、盖度和生活型,(4)灌木样方的优势种、物种数、密度、优势种平均高度和总盖度,(5)草本层物种名、多度、平均高度、盖度和生活型,(6)草本样方的优势种、物种数、密度、优势种平均高度、总盖度。建立和共享本数据集可为深入探究环境变化对被亚热带森林生态系统的群落结构与生产力影响等相关研究提供本底数据,为该地区的生态系统服务功能评价、生物多样性保育及生态质量监测提供基础数据支撑。

Abstract: Plant species composition and community characteristics are the basis for the structure, function and dynamics of forest ecosystems, which determines forest ecosystem services such as productivity, carbon sequestration and biodiversity conservation. Plant species composition and community characteristics are important indicators for long-term positional observation of biological elements in terrestrial ecosystems by the China Ecosystem Research Network (CERN) and the National Ecosystem Observation and Research Network (CNERN). Mixed evergreen and deciduous broadleaf forest is a zonal vegetation type in northern subtropical China, and is one of the vegetation types that responds sensitively to environmental change. Subalpine coniferous forest is a typical vegetation type in the upper part of the vertical belt spectrum of the Shennongjia mountainous area, preserving a large area of natural primary forests that are the only remaining ones in Central China, and it is an important ecological barrier in the Qinba mountainous area. Two 100 m × 100 m long-term monitoring sample plots of subalpine coniferous forest and mixed evergreen and deciduous broadleaf forest have been set up in 2001 and in 2008, respectively, by the Shennongjia Forest Ecosystem Research Station (National Field Station for Forest Ecosystems in Shennongjia, also known as Shennongjia Biodiversity Research Station of CAS). Plant community inventories were conducted in 2010 in accordance with CERN and CNERN monitoring specifications. Tree layer surveys were conducted in 100 10 m × 10 m sub-samples, and shrub and herb layer surveys were conducted in 13 10 m × 10 m sub-samples. In the tree layer, all woody plants with diameter at breast height (DBH) ≥ 1 cm were surveyed, and the indicators included plant species name, diameter at breast height (DBH), height, etc. In the shrub layer, woody plants with DBH < 1 cm were monitored, and the indicators included species name, multiplicity, average basal diameter, average height, and cover, etc. In the herb layer, herbaceous plants were monitored, and the indicators included species name, multiplicity, average height, and cover. Six data tables for this dataset were formed through statistical organization: (1) species name, abundance, average diameter at breast height (DBH), average height, coverage, and life form of the tree layer, (2) dominant species, number of species, density, average height of dominant species, and canopy density of the sub-sample plots of trees, (3) species name, abundance, average base diameter, average height, coverage, and life form of the shrub layer, (4) dominant species, number of species, density, average height of dominant species, and total coverage of the shrub sample plot, (5) species name, abundance, average height, coverage, and life form of the herbaceous layer, and (6) dominant species, number of species, density, average height of dominant species, and total coverage of the herbaceous sample plot. The establishment and sharing of this dataset can provide background data for in-depth investigation of the impact of environmental changes on the community structure and productivity of subtropical forest ecosystems, and provide basic data support for the evaluation of ecosystem service functions, biodiversity conservation and ecological quality monitoring in the region.
